about

All songs written by The Symbolick Jews. Inspired by God's perfect light and protected by violent spirits. 2011.

Extra special thanks to the following individuals for making this possible: Gary Thorn, Peter Berends, Chris LasPinas, Tom Meagher, Douglas & Mary Davy, Candyce Hubbell, & Tyla Healton

credits

released August 20, 2011

Adam Healton: Vocals, Guitar, Bass, Keyboard
Brian Davy: Drums, Synth, Percussion
Jasper Leach: Guitar, Bass, Vocals, Accordion
Burd "PunkPinoyAFI" Quines: Bass, Vocals
Paul Korte: Guitar, Vocals, Bells, Ukulele, Acoustic Guitar
Vanessa Robinson: Vocals, Keyboard
Briana Moreno: Backing Vocals on Liquid Liquid
Benjamin Dreyer: Whistling on Liquid Liquid
Megan Dabkowski: Backing vocals on Maha mo Ako


Recorded at Temple Randolph by Brian Davy
Additional Engineers: Jasper Leach, Paul Korte
Mixed by Brian Davy with Jasper Leach
Cover Art by Mel Marzhal
Back Photo by James Leon
